    Nearby and Getting Around

    Seaview Park is perfectly positioned for exploring the local area:

    • Barton’s Point Coastal Park – over 40 acres of natural beauty, with a salt-water lake, kayaking, boating, and a 9-hole pitch and putt golf course.
    • Sheerness – home to Blue Town Heritage Centre and Criterion Music Hall and Cinema.
    • Queenborough – visit the historic castle remnants commissioned by Edward III.
    • Canterbury – historic city with its world-famous Cathedral (approx. 30–45 minutes’ drive).
    • Maidstone – county town offering river walks and shopping centres.
    • Ashford – major travel hub with McArthur Glenn outlet shopping (approx. 30–45 minutes’ drive).
